From: Exploring heterologous prime-boost vaccination approaches to enhance influenza control in pigs

Figure 2

Clinical and pathology assessment of the pigs from different treatment groups after challenge. A Average daily weight gain (ADG) calculated from challenge to necropsy by treatment group. The ADG for pigs in multiple groups are summarized as the boxplots in grams and each data point represents an individual pig. The dark blue, green and dark red bars and data points represent the pigs from the whole inactivate vaccine comparisons, negative control and live attenuate vaccine comparison groups respectively. B Individual pig body temperature (°C) values by group from day prior to inoculation to necropsy. The daily body temperature (°C) for pigs in different treatment group are summarized as mean (± SEM) by bar plots and each data point represents an individual pig. The dark blue, green and dark red bars and data points represent the pigs from the whole inactivated vaccine comparisons, negative control and live attenuated vaccine comparison groups respectively. The 40.0 centigrade was set up as the threshold for fever and represented as the horizontal line. C The gross lung lesions for pigs at necropsy by treatment groups. The gross lung lesions for pigs are shown as percentage and presented by boxplots. Each data point indicates an individual pig. The colors for boxplots and data points are same as in A.
